If you plan to study Plant Sciences, consider the program at Mitchell Technical College. The following information will help you decide if it is a good fit for you.

Mitchell Technical College is located in Mitchell, SD.

During the most recent reporting year, 11 plant sciences degrees were granted at Mitchell Technical College.

Online & Distance Learning at Mitchell Technical College

Online coursework is an option at Mitchell Technical College. Among 1,186 students, 210 (18%) studied exclusively online and 102 (9%) took at least some classes online.

Student Demographics & Diversity

Below you’ll find the student demographics for Plant Sciences graduates at Mitchell Technical College, broken down by degree level.

Looking at the program as a whole, Plant Sciences graduates at Mitchell Technical College are 9% women (1) and 91% men (10).

Plant Sciences Associate’s Program at Mitchell Technical College

Among the 11 associate’s plant sciences graduates at Mitchell Technical College, 9% were women (1) and 91% were men (10).
